Web17 jan. 2024 · For barter, participants directly exchange goods or services in a transaction for other goods or services without using a medium of exchange, such as money. 1 … Web24 mrt. 2024 · Money rapidly lost its value. People were unwilling to exchange real goods for Germany’s depreciating currency. They resorted to barter or to other inefficient money substitutes (such as cigarettes). … Web17 jul. 2024 · Barter is an act of exchange involving goods or services without the use of money or any other monetary medium.
